    #include <cstdlib>
    #include <cassert>
    #include <cmath>
    #include <iostream>
    #include <fstream>
    
    #include "ModelTree.hh"
    #include "MinimumFeedbackSet.hh"
    #include <boost/graph/adjacency_list.hpp>
    #include <boost/graph/max_cardinality_matching.hpp>
    #include <boost/graph/strong_components.hpp>
    #include <boost/graph/topological_sort.hpp>
    
    using namespace boost;
    using namespace MFS;
    
    bool
    ModelTree::computeNormalization(const jacob_map_t &contemporaneous_jacobian, bool verbose)
    {
      const int n = equations.size();
    
      assert(n == symbol_table.endo_nbr());
    
      typedef adjacency_list<vecS, vecS, undirectedS> BipartiteGraph;
    
      /*
        Vertices 0 to n-1 are for endogenous (using type specific ID)
        Vertices n to 2*n-1 are for equations (using equation no.)
      */
      BipartiteGraph g(2 * n);
    
      // Fill in the graph
      set<pair<int, int> > endo;
    
      for (jacob_map_t::const_iterator it = contemporaneous_jacobian.begin(); it != contemporaneous_jacobian.end(); it++)
        add_edge(it->first.first + n, it->first.second, g);
    
      // Compute maximum cardinality matching
      vector<int> mate_map(2*n);
    
    #if 1
      bool check = checked_edmonds_maximum_cardinality_matching(g, &mate_map[0]);
    #else // Alternative way to compute normalization, by giving an initial matching using natural normalizations
      fill(mate_map.begin(), mate_map.end(), graph_traits<BipartiteGraph>::null_vertex());
    
      multimap<int, int> natural_endo2eqs;
      computeNormalizedEquations(natural_endo2eqs);
    
      for (int i = 0; i < symbol_table.endo_nbr(); i++)
        {
          if (natural_endo2eqs.count(i) == 0)
            continue;
    
          int j = natural_endo2eqs.find(i)->second;
    
          put(&mate_map[0], i, n+j);
          put(&mate_map[0], n+j, i);
        }
    
      edmonds_augmenting_path_finder<BipartiteGraph, size_t *, property_map<BipartiteGraph, vertex_index_t>::type> augmentor(g, &mate_map[0], get(vertex_index, g));
      bool not_maximum_yet = true;
      while (not_maximum_yet)
        {
          not_maximum_yet = augmentor.augment_matching();
        }
      augmentor.get_current_matching(&mate_map[0]);
    
      bool check = maximum_cardinality_matching_verifier<BipartiteGraph, size_t *, property_map<BipartiteGraph, vertex_index_t>::type>::verify_matching(g, &mate_map[0], get(vertex_index, g));
    #endif
    
      assert(check);
    
    #ifdef DEBUG
      for (int i = 0; i < n; i++)
        cout << "Endogenous " << symbol_table.getName(symbol_table.getID(eEndogenous, i))
             << " matched with equation " << (mate_map[i]-n+1) << endl;
    #endif
    
      // Create the resulting map, by copying the n first elements of mate_map, and substracting n to them
      endo2eq.resize(equations.size());
      transform(mate_map.begin(), mate_map.begin() + n, endo2eq.begin(), bind2nd(minus<int>(), n));
    
    #ifdef DEBUG
      multimap<int, int> natural_endo2eqs;
      computeNormalizedEquations(natural_endo2eqs);
    
      int n1 = 0, n2 = 0;
    
      for (int i = 0; i < symbol_table.endo_nbr(); i++)
        {
          if (natural_endo2eqs.count(i) == 0)
            continue;
    
          n1++;
    
          pair<multimap<int, int>::const_iterator, multimap<int, int>::const_iterator> x = natural_endo2eqs.equal_range(i);
          if (find_if(x.first, x.second, compose1(bind2nd(equal_to<int>(), endo2eq[i]), select2nd<multimap<int, int>::value_type>())) == x.second)
            cout << "Natural normalization of variable " << symbol_table.getName(symbol_table.getID(eEndogenous, i))
                 << " not used." << endl;
          else
            n2++;
        }
    
      cout << "Used " << n2 << " natural normalizations out of " << n1 << ", for a total of " << n << " equations." << endl;
    #endif
    
      // Check if all variables are normalized
      vector<int>::const_iterator it = find(mate_map.begin(), mate_map.begin() + n, graph_traits<BipartiteGraph>::null_vertex());
      if (it != mate_map.begin() + n)
        {
          if (verbose)
            cerr << "ERROR: Could not normalize the model. Variable "
                 << symbol_table.getName(symbol_table.getID(eEndogenous, it - mate_map.begin()))
                 << " is not in the maximum cardinality matching." << endl;
          check = false;
        }
      return check;
    }
    
    void
    ModelTree::computeNonSingularNormalization(jacob_map_t &contemporaneous_jacobian, double cutoff, jacob_map_t &static_jacobian, dynamic_jacob_map_t &dynamic_jacobian)
    {
      bool check = false;
    
      cout << "Normalizing the model..." << endl;
    
      int n = equations.size();
    
      // compute the maximum value of each row of the contemporaneous Jacobian matrix
      //jacob_map norm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ian;
      jacob_map_t norm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ian(contemporaneous_jacobian);
      vector<double> max_val(n, 0.0);
      for (jacob_map_t::const_iterator iter = contemporaneous_jacobian.begin(); iter != contemporaneous_jacobian.end(); iter++)
        if (fabs(iter->second) > max_val[iter->first.first])
          max_val[iter->first.first] = fabs(iter->second);
    
      for (jacob_map_t::iterator iter = norm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ian.begin(); iter != norm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ian.end(); iter++)
        iter->second /= max_val[iter->first.first];
    
      //We start with the highest value of the cutoff and try to normalize the model
      double current_cutoff = 0.99999999;
    
      int suppressed = 0;
      while (!check && current_cutoff > 1e-19)
        {
          jacob_map_t t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ian;
          int suppress = 0;
          for (jacob_map_t::iterator iter = norm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ian.begin(); iter != norm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ian.end(); iter++)
            if (fabs(iter->second) > max(current_cutoff, cutoff))
              t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ian[make_pair(iter->first.first, iter->first.second)] = iter->second;
            else
              suppress++;
    
          if (suppress != suppressed)
            check = computeNormalization(t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ian, false);
          suppressed = suppress;
          if (!check)
            {
              current_cutoff /= 2;
              // In this last case try to normalize with the complete jacobian
              if (current_cutoff <= 1e-19)
                check = computeNormalization(norm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ian, false);
            }
        }
    
      if (!check)
        {
          cout << "Normalization failed with cutoff, trying symbolic normalization..." << endl;
          //if no non-singular normalization can be found, try to find a normalization even with a potential singularity
          jacob_map_t t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ian;
          set<pair<int, int> > endo;
          for (int i = 0; i < n; i++)
            {
              endo.clear();
              equations[i]->collectEndogenous(endo);
              for (set<pair<int, int> >::const_iterator it = endo.begin(); it != endo.end(); it++)
                t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ian[make_pair(i, it->first)] = 1;
            }
          check = computeNormalization(t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ian, true);
          if (check)
            {
              // Update the jacobian matrix
              for (jacob_map_t::const_iterator it = t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ian.begin(); it != tmp_normalized_contemporaneous_jacobian.end(); it++)
                {
                  if (static_jacobian.find(make_pair(it->first.first, it->first.second)) == static_jacobian.end())
                    static_jacobian[make_pair(it->first.first, it->first.second)] = 0;
                  if (dynamic_jacobian.find(make_pair(0, make_pair(it->first.first, it->first.second))) == dynamic_jacobian.end())
                    dynamic_jacobian[make_pair(0, make_pair(it->first.first, it->first.second))] = 0;
                  if (contemporaneous_jacobian.find(make_pair(it->first.first, it->first.second)) == contemporaneous_jacobian.end())
                    contemporaneous_jacobian[make_pair(it->first.first, it->first.second)] = 0;
                  try
                    {
                      if (first_derivatives.find(make_pair(it->first.first, getDerivID(symbol_table.getID(eEndogenous, it->first.second), 0))) == first_derivatives.end())
                        first_derivatives[make_pair(it->first.first, getDerivID(symbol_table.getID(eEndogenous, it->first.second), 0))] = Zero;
                    }
                  catch (DataTree::UnknownDerivIDException &e)
                    {
                      cerr << "The variable " << symbol_table.getName(symbol_table.getID(eEndogenous, it->first.second))
                           << " does not appear at the current period (i.e. with no lead and no lag); this case is not handled by the 'block' option of the 'model' block." << endl;
                      ex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
                    }
                }
            }
        }
    
      if (!check)
        {
          cerr << "No normalization could be computed. Aborting." << endl;
          ex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
        }
    }
